UGC is Reshaping B2B Purchaser Conduct

Let’s be trustworthy: B2B advertising and marketing is dealing with a belief disaster. Our ebooks and webinars at the moment are met with skepticism. Consumers are drowning in a sea of AI-generated noise and unsupported claims. 

“This sort of content material [AI generated] is polluting social streams and decreasing belief,” remarks Andy Crestodina, Chief Advertising Officer at Orbit Media Studios. 

So, the place are they turning? To not us, the manufacturers, however to one another. They’re searching Reddit threads, inspecting G2 evaluations, and are tuning into unfiltered opinions on LinkedIn. They’re in search of proof, not a pitch. 

This shift is reshaping the B2B purchaser journey. The linear, predictable gross sales funnel we’ve spent a long time mastering is subverted. Immediately’s B2B purchaser is an investigator, placing each resolution by rigorous exams. The funnel shouldn’t be a self-directed gauntlet. And user-generated content material (UGC) tops the proof to assist them resolve. Based on a report, 92% of B2B customers belief peer suggestions above all different types of promoting.

On this article, we discover how UGC is reshaping the B2B purchaser journey and what entrepreneurs can do to take advantage of it.

The self-directed buyer

The evolving funnel doesn’t symbolize a neat, brand-moderated journey from consciousness to buy. It’s a self-directed and cyclical course of. 

The rising mannequin doesn’t have the client as a passive recipient of selling. They’re an energetic investigator, placing the claims made by manufacturers and options by a sequence of exams. At each stage, they search genuine proof to validate considering and mitigate dangers. UGC is the first proof they use to navigate this journey. The 4 reshaped levels are:

Stage 1: Drawback validation and neighborhood consensus 

Immediately’s purchaser turns to digital communities as quickly as a ache level emerges. Their first query isn’t, “What product can clear up this?” As an alternative, it’s, “Is anybody else coping with this?” They search course and consensus in the neighborhood to verify that their drawback is actual and solvable.

Consumers head to industry-specific subreddits or Quora threads, in search of situations that mirror their very own issues. Gurmit Singh, Basic Supervisor for APAC & MEA at Quora, explains this: “Sellers can have a enterprise profile on Quora and submit Q&As on it. This helps patrons and companies analysis, consider, and finally decide.” He means that patrons worth opinions and comparisons shared by people and workers. 

Equally, Reddit’s energy lies in its community-led construction. Camilla Kalvaria, Director of Product Advertising at Reddit, says, “Folks look to the knowledge of over 100,000 communities which are trusted for considerate suggestions…belief is earned and never based mostly on a follower rely.” 

On this preliminary stage, patrons validate their issues by confirming if others face them. This offers them confidence in in search of options.

Stage 2: Impartial analysis 

After validating the issue, the client launches into unbiased analysis to search for options. G2’s Purchaser Conduct Report, 2025, suggests that almost all patrons want this discovery section to be self-directed. They don’t need to meet gross sales reps but. And they’re extra environment friendly of their analysis.  

“The time spent within the analysis section has compressed considerably, shrinking from 43% of the entire journey time in 2024 to simply 31% in 2025.”

G2’s Purchaser Conduct Report, 2025

This shift is enabled by the instruments patrons belief. The report means that conventional search is now not the default start line for firms. For bigger corporations (1,000 – 5,000 workers), software program assessment websites are the popular analysis supply (61% of patrons use them), adopted by AI search. 

Throughout this stage, patrons are evaluating choices based mostly on UGC throughout a number of fronts: 

Studying evaluations: Consumers depend on peer assessment websites like G2 to gauge person sentiment round options, pricing, implementation, and help. 

Utilizing AI search: The G2 report notes that 30% of patrons discover AI search extra productive than conventional search. AI chatbots are essentially the most influential exterior supply for shaping vendor assessments, rating twice as influential as salespeople. 

Analyzing social media: Consumers proceed to scroll by communities like LinkedIn, X, and Reddit to view how professionals are utilizing the instruments in on a regular basis work. 

This hyper-efficient analysis is shortening the analysis cycle dramatically. The G2 report has discovered that shortlists are narrowed down to simply two or three distributors. At this stage, patrons use UGC, sorted by assessment platforms and AI, to create an knowledgeable view even earlier than a model has the possibility to make a pitch.

Stage 3: The human examine

After unbiased analysis, the client arrives at an inflection level. They’ve narrowed down their choices to 2 or three doubtless contenders, armed with information from evaluations, neighborhood boards, and AI and web searches. But, they want human confidence to validate the options. This stage is much less about options. It’s extra about corroborating their findings with genuine human proof to de-risk choices, each professionally and personally. 

The necessity for human validation is pushed by psychology. Hassan S. Ali, Senior Director of Model and Communications at Hootsuite, acutely observes that the largest concern most B2B patrons have shouldn’t be in regards to the software program failing, however about their very own judgment: “‘I don’t need to look silly in entrance of my boss.’ or ‘Don’t make me remorse this.’”

Additional, G2’s Purchaser Conduct Report, 2025, notes that B2B shopping for committees are shrinking. With fewer individuals accountable, validation is extra vital now, as their credibility is extra brazenly on the road. That is the place UGC helps validate information.

There are completely different layers of this human examine. 

Noticed expertise: This includes patrons seeing and listening to from actual customers with out direct interplay. This may be by video testimonials, written case research, or company-led boards. Andy says that testimonial movies are vital “supportive proof” that advertising and marketing pages have to convert, particularly when most advertising and marketing web sites are “stuffed with unsupported advertising and marketing claims.” 

Direct validation: This consists of interactions with different prospects or distributors in a managed setting, similar to throughout a webinar or a LinkedIn dwell session. This speaks on to what prospects need, as Leandro Perez, Chief Advertising Officer for Australia & New Zealand at Salesforce, places it: “They need to hear from ‘somebody like me’ — a peer of their {industry}, geography, or function who’s used Salesforce to unravel a fancy problem.” 

Backchannel: The ultimate and most influential examine occurs behind the scenes. Consumers could attain out to current prospects and workers of the seller privately.  

After human validation, the patrons get able to work together with a vendor. The G2 report is obvious about this: Round 62% of patrons want to interact with a salesman solely within the later a part of their journeys.

Stage 4: Inner advocacy and stakeholder alignment 

B2B purchases are committee choices. The client’s resolution should be bought to a bunch of inner stakeholders in numerous groups. The client (let’s name them a champion) right here turns into an inner advocate, and UGC turns into their major ammunition, together with different vendor-shared information.

Based on the G2 report, decision-making energy is shifting. Though the C-suite remains to be influential, the ability is shifting to departmental leaders and end-users. Their authority in resolution making is surging. This implies the champion isn’t simply influencing the choice. More and more, they’re additionally making it based mostly on consensus. 

“We purpose to match content material to mindset. So when a prospect is narrowing choices or presenting to their Chief Monetary Officer, the voice that reassures them is a fellow buyer’s, not ours.”

Leandro Perez
Chief Advertising Officer for Australia, New Zealand at Salesforce

The champion should have the best piece of UGC for the best stakeholder:

1. For the finance workforce: A case research with ROI information and income advantages, most likely from an organization of the same dimension and {industry}. Time-to-value metrics from peer assessment websites and on-line boards. 

2. For the IT workforce: The G2 report reveals that IT departments are concerned in almost half (47%) of all software program buying choices. A technical assessment from peer assessment platforms like G2 might assist right here. Champions may confer with Reddit threads or Quora communities to assessment implementation and establish potential hurdles and options. 

3. For the person: Relatable video testimonials and sentiment evaluation from professionals in the same function who love utilizing the product, and displaying the presence of on-line varieties the place customers actively assist one another out to point out management that there’s help past the official assist desk.

On this last stage, UGC turns into a sales-enablement software. It equips the champion to maneuver past opinion and current multi-pronged, evidence-based arguments. 

Fashionable B2B patrons’ journeys are decentralized and self-directed. They demand genuine proof and are closely depending on UGC from friends, workers, and unbiased specialists. It’s now not about pushing patrons by a funnel however about actively collaborating in and shaping the ecosystem of conversations the place they now make choices. This requires a pivot to creating content material to catalyze an ecosystem of user-generated proof.

Methods to create a UGC ecosystem for B2B firms

Entrepreneurs at present should eagerly form the rising purchaser journey. Their function has advanced. As Leandro places it, we should shift our considering to “much less like editors and extra like catalysts.” Our job is to not sanitize tales, however amplify them. 

As an important first step, we should broaden our understanding of UGC. Hassan argues, “I believe it’s time we increase what UGC means. It’s not simply selfies and product unboxings. It’s G2 evaluations. It’s B2B influencers. It’s worker posts. It’s a CEO on LinkedIn.”

With this definition in thoughts, let’s talk about methods for creating the ecosystem:

1. Create differentiated, human-led content material

Within the AI age, essentially the most helpful content material is the one that may’t be replicated. Andy mentions two areas: true thought management, the place a model or an individual takes a powerful stance on a subject, and new authentic analysis, the place a model turns into the first supply by publishing brand-new information that did not exist. By creating authentic content material and stoking discussions inside boards, you’ll be able to flip your thought management right into a catalyst for UGC.

2. Activate your inner and exterior advocates 

Your most influential voices are sometimes those closest to you. Andy says, “Influencers aren’t simply celebrities. All of us are influencers and model advocates for sure manufacturers…each model has followers.” The secret is to find and empower them. 

Worker advocacy helps you humanize your model by encouraging workers to point out the behind-the-scenes of a office. Based on Hassan, Hootsuite Chief Govt Officer Irina Novoselsky drives 4 million impressions on her LinkedIn content material each month, which Hassan equates to “$133k in advert spend, without cost.”

Equally, constructing a consumer advocacy or a model ambassador program may help produce a gradual stream of UGC. The G2 Icons program, which empowers star reviewers, is amongst them.

3. Focus extra on natural affect 

There’s a powerful argument to put an natural relationship first. Andy says, “You needn’t pay cash. You want followers. You may’t pay individuals to like you…each model has these individuals, discover these first earlier than you concentrate on writing a examine to anyone.” The endorsement by your actual followers is extra dependable and plausible because it’s rooted in an actual affinity to your model. It’s usually “far better and much cheaper than a paid influencer program.”

To spice up natural UGC, manufacturers should make it simpler for followers to create content material. Based on a report, 64% of customers agree that when a model they like and use re-shares content material by prospects, they’re extra more likely to share content material in regards to the model or its merchandise.

4. Depend on expertise

The quantity of UGC on-line is a chance and a problem for firms. That’s the place expertise helps. First, it’s serving to carry order to the chaos. As Neeraja Prakash, Affiliate Market Analysis Analyst at G2, explains, “platforms like Partitions.io and Adobe Expertise Cloud are essential for organizing, scheduling, and publishing content material, whereas instruments like Sprint Social and Synup present the vital efficiency metrics to show ROI and handle on-line repute.”

Subsequent, as manufacturers mature, they face the hurdle of high quality management. AI turns into a robust ally in curation right here. “UGC options like Tagshop make the most of AI-powered content material moderation and curation to automate high quality management,” says Neeraja. 

But, the superior approach to make use of expertise for UGC shouldn’t be merely managing it however proactively listening for insights that may form your small business technique. Hassan explains this by sharing the story of a basketball workforce that used Hootsuite to find that followers wished extra “UGC-like, behind-the-scenes content material.” This perception led to an entire shift of their social technique. For B2B firms, he provides, these patterns can inform all the pieces from product roadmaps to CEO LinkedIn content material pillars.

5. Optimize your UGC for the AI search period 

Consumers are more and more utilizing AI seek for analysis, so your UGC should be optimized for it. The G2 report recommends that you just “convert product paperwork, launch notes, and FAQs into chunked, schema-rich feeds optimized for chatbots and copilots.”

Manufacturers should use schema markup to tag reviewers, rankings, and merchandise being reviewed for big language fashions (LLM) to have the ability to parse data and probably characteristic it in a generative AI reply. You have to additionally create your finest UGC — case research, success tales, and evaluations — into hubs. Additional, make sure you steadiness gated with ungated content material, as parsers discovered it troublesome to glean data from gated content material.

The daybreak of customer-led manufacturers 

B2B advertising and marketing, with UGC, is experiencing its Napster second. Just like the peer-to-peer networks disrupted the music {industry}, UGC is dismantling company content material monopolies. 

The financial implications are profound. Each greenback spent on branded content material now competes in opposition to infinite, free, and peer-generated content material. Early adopters of the UGC will bear an even bigger fruit. 

The behavioral psychology shift is actual. Consumers method content material with skepticism now. This isn’t a development however an evolutionary adaptation to data overload and saturation with AI-driven content material. Corporations are now not competing for consideration alone. They’re battling for credibility when authenticity is an appreciating forex. 

The client funnel is reshaping. Entrepreneurs should abandon the linear conception and monitor how prospects transfer by networks for buyer advocates quite than marketing campaign sequences alone. Consumers at the moment are looped in credibility cycles. 

This implies Web Promoter Rating, within the UGC age, is turning into a extra essential income issue. Corporations with one of the best merchandise is not going to at all times win. However firms whose prospects change into their most influential salespeople will.
